## Environment variables — Nightfill scheduler

Nightfill runs the nightly backfill jobs for the Marrowgate warehouse. Each variable below is required: `NIGHTFILL_WINDOW_START`, `NIGHTFILL_MAX_PARALLEL`, and `NIGHTFILL_TARGET_DB`. Values are validated at startup, so a typo fails fast. The scheduler also needs credentials to enqueue jobs; that credential is set on the very next line.

env line for fafof-fahag: LEDGER_TOKEN5=f8790

Internal Memo — Budget Request

To the sales leads: Operations has submitted a budget request to fund two additional demo kits for the Vellane product line and travel support for the Ashgrove territory push. Finance expects a decision within two weeks. No changes to current spending limits until then; log any urgent needs with your regional coordinator. Background on the request's purpose appears below.

board note of fahaf-fadug: Gilixax Logistics is in early talks to buy Praiusax Partners for about $8.1 million. The Pramir launch date is September 23, and nothing goes to the press before then.

Q: How do I get into the data-centre cage at night?

A: Night-shift staff must sign the cage log at the guard post, verify the visit is on the schedule, and carry no unlogged media. The outer hall uses your normal badge; the cage itself has a keypad. Enter the cage code below.

turnstile pass: bdg-FVNQRS-72965873

**Checklist: Quillpress markdown pipeline.** Confirm fenced code blocks render with correct language hints. Verify nested blockquotes don't collapse past depth three. Run the Tandermoor regression corpus; zero diffs required. Check sanitizer strips inline event handlers. Smoke-test table alignment on the staging renderer. No release without all four green. Attach the build token below for the audit log.

build token for tawip-yageg: htk9_92ac43d42